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
We send a trained technician to assess the damage and identify the extent of the problem. This helps us create a customized repair plan tailored to your specific needs. Our technician will also provide a detailed report outlining the necessary repairs and estimated costs.
Step 2: Demolition and Removal
Our team will carefully remove the damaged flooring, taking care to preserve any unaffected areas. This ensures a smooth transition to the repair phase. We use specialized equipment, such as flooring removal machines to make the process as efficient as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Using industrial dehumidifiers we’ll remove excess moisture from the affected area, preventing further damage and ensuring a safe environment for repair. Our team will also use infrared drying machines to spe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Installation and Replacement
Once the area is dry, our team will install new flooring, ensuring a seamless transition and a safe, secure environment for your family. We use only the highest-quality materials to ensure your new flooring lasts for years to come.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Copper Canyon, TX
The cost of flooring replacement after water dam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Copper Canyon, TX.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ized repair plan.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Minor Water Damage Repair |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and extent of damage |
| Extensive Flooring Replacement | $2,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and extent of damage |
| Hidden Water Damage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and extent of damage |
| Water Damage Cleanup and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and extent of damage |
| Insurance Claims Help | $0 – $500 | Complexity of insurance claims and extent of damage |
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Time of day, severity of damage, and location |
